Luxe Foods is contemplating acquisition of Valley Canning Company for a cash price of $180,000. Luxe currently has high financial leverage and therefore has a cost of capital of 14%. As a result of acquiring Valley Canning, which is financed entirely with equity, the firm expects its financial leverage to be reduced and its cost of capital to drop to 11%. The acquisition of Valley Canning is expected to increase Luxe's cash inflows by $20,000 per year for the first 3 years and by $30,000 per year for the next following 12 years.
Required:
- Determine whether the proposed cash acquisition is financially justified. Explain your answer.
- If the firm's financial leverage would actually remain unchanged as a result of the proposed acquisition, would this alter your recommendation in part (a) above? Support your answer with numerical data.
